1. Lead Acid Battery

This is the most common and the most traditional type of battery used in many cars.

The basis of operation involves a reaction between lead and lead oxide in a liquid electrolyte, which is typically a solution of sulfuric acid and water. 

But because of the liquid electrolyte’s nature, evaporation can happen over time, thus reducing battery performance.

Because of this, these  batteries need to be maintained on a regular basis and topped out with distilled water.

There are two types of lead acid batteries including:

  • SLI Battery
  • Deep Cycle Battery

Pros:

  • Reliability
  • Cost-effective
  • Accessibility

Cons:

  • Might need regular maintenance
  • Evaporation issues can affect battery performance over time.

2. VRLA Batteries (Valve-Regulated Lead-Acid Batteries)

The next one is the VRLA battery or more commonly known as sealed lead-acid batteries.

These are an advancement in battery technology as these batteries are sealed and maintenance-free, thus you don’t need to top it up with a distilled water.

There are also two types of VRLA batteries, including:

  • Gel Cell Battery
  • Absorbed Glass Matt (AGM) Battery

3. Lithium-Ion Battery

These are the batteries most commonly used in electric vehicles (EVs) and also in the plug-in hybrid electric vehicles (PHEvs).

The lithium-ion batteries is a recyclable and eco friendly option that have a high power-to-weight ratio and have a low self-discharge and also an excellent energy efficiency.

Pros:

  • High energy efficiency
  • Eco-friendly

Cons:

  • Tends to be more expensive
  • Overheating concerns

4. Sodium Ion Battery

The sodium ion batteries are like the substitute for lithium ion batteries.

The sodium ion batteries are still in development and projected to be a more sustainable and affordable option than lithium ion batteries as the sodium is more widely available and easier to extract than lithium.

Pros:

  • Widely available resource
  • Sustainability

Cons:

  • Still in development

5. Solid State Battery

The solid-state batteries are a fast charging and high power input newer technology that is said will replaces the liquid or gel electrolyte and electrodes that are present in conventional lithium-ion batteries.

Pros:

  • Fast Charging
  • Higher power input

Cons:

  • Harder to manufacture
  • May take several years to widely available on the market

6. Nikel-Metal Hydride Battery (NiMH)

The NiMH battery is a popular type of rechargeable battery that is well-known for its versatility and eco-friendliness.

NiMH batteries employ a metal alloy negative electrode that absorbs hydrogen in addition to positive electrodes made of nickel oxyhydroxide (NiOOH). 

The battery’s negative electrode absorbs hydrogen and the positive electrodes oxidize during charging, resulting in the creation of metal hydride. 

The opposite reaction takes place during the discharging process, producing electrical energy.

Pros:

  • Higher Energy Density
  • Rechargeable
  • Eco-Friendly 

Cons:

  • High self-discharge rate
  • Memory effect

7. SIlver Calcium Battery

The silver calcium batteries are also an innovation in automotive battery technology that offers an enhanced efficiency, performance and also longer lifespan than that of traditional lead-acid batteries.

The positive grids of these batteries are constructed from alloys of silver and calcium.

The silver calcium batteries use silver to strengthen the battery’s mechanical properties and increase its ability to withstand corrosion, thus resulting in longer lifespan.

The low self-discharge rate and extended shelf life of the battery are attributed to the sophisticated grid design and the use of calcium alloys in the negative plates.

Pros:

  • Higher starting power
  • Low-maintenance
  • Longer lifespan

Cons:

  • More expensive
